Introduction:
This course explains harmonics, requirement of fourier analysis & total harmonics distortion in detail. Main aim of this course is to help student for clearing all doubt about harmonics & its calculation methods.
First section covers method to obtain THD and harmonics spectrum of different waveform. It explains important of harmonics analysis and role of Fourier series in obtaining harmonics spectrum.
Second includes MATLAB programming & simulation tools to obtain THD as well as harmonics spectrum of different waveform. It explains about using FFT toolbox and THD function of MATLAB
Third section analyze harmonics profile of all kinds of power electronics converters and explains how it produces harmonics at different stages and effect how it affects load side as well as supply side.
